DocumentCode :
3028380
Title :
Luvalley-Lite: An Effort to Balance Re-use and Re-coding
Author :
Liu, XiaoJian ; Yi, Xiaodong ; Ren, Yi
Author_Institution :
Sch. of Comput., NUDT, Changsha, China
fYear :
2009
fDate :
10-12 Aug. 2009
Firstpage :
537
Lastpage :
542
Abstract :
When constructing a virtual machine monitor (VMM), there are two different trends. The first one is trying to make the VMM be self-inclusive, while the second one is to make the VMM part of the host operating system. The former is prefered by independent virtualization provider (IVP) or BIOS manufacturer, and the later is advocated by OS vendors. In this article, after analyzing the implementation of three prevail VMMs, it is argued that: 1) unless the VMM is used as part of the BIOS, being self-inclusive is not a wise decision; 2) overly utilizing the existing functions that the underlying host operating system provides can not produce good solution to the problem of computer system virtualization. The design philosophy, architecture and implementation of Luvalley-lite is introduced to show our efforts to make a balance between reusing commodity OS functions and fitting the virtualization environment well. The approach of avoiding being restricted by the GPL license is also described. Due to the lack of publicly acknowledged performance benchmark, only preliminary experiments are conducted.
Keywords :
operating systems (computers); system monitoring; virtual machines; BIOS manufacturer; GPL license; Luvalley-lite; balance recoding; balance reusing; computer system virtualization; host operating system; independent virtualization provider; virtual machine monitor; Computerized monitoring; Concurrent computing; Condition monitoring; Distributed computing; Hardware; Linux; Memory management; Operating systems; Virtual machine monitors; Virtual machining;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Parallel and Distributed Processing with Applications, 2009 IEEE International Symposium on
Conference_Location :
Chengdu
Print_ISBN :
978-0-7695-3747-4
Type :
conf
DOI :
10.1109/ISPA.2009.31
Filename :
5207883
Link To Document :
بازگشت